Summary
An Act To Amend Section 37-23-69, Mississippi Code Of 1972, To Provide That Certain Exceptional Children Who Are Determined To Require Placement In A Private Intermediate Care Facility For The Mentally Retarded Or A Psychiatric Residential Treatment Facility Operating An Accredited Nonpublic School Shall Be Eligible And Entitled To Receive State Financial Assistance For The Full Term Of The Placement; To Amend Section 37-23-63, Mississippi Code Of 1972, To Clarify That Certain Exceptional Children Attending A Nonpublic School Are Eligible To Receive State Financial Assistance; And For Related Purposes.
Title
Exceptional children in inpatient facilities; shall be eligible for state financial assistance for full term of placement.
